How they compare

Norway currently reports 24,312 constant 2015 US$ per person against 7,925 constant 2015 US$ per person in Euro area, a difference of 16,387 constant 2015 US$ per person.

That makes Norway's figure about 3.1 times Euro area's.

Across all 35 years both countries report, Norway has been ahead every year.

Euro area ranks 3rd and Norway ranks 5th of 45 groups.

Norway has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Euro area Norway Difference Ahead
1990s 6,740 constant 2015 US$ per person 23,589 constant 2015 US$ per person 16,849 constant 2015 US$ per person Norway
2000s 7,508 constant 2015 US$ per person 27,167 constant 2015 US$ per person 19,659 constant 2015 US$ per person Norway
2010s 7,434 constant 2015 US$ per person 23,934 constant 2015 US$ per person 16,500 constant 2015 US$ per person Norway
2020s 7,818 constant 2015 US$ per person 24,498 constant 2015 US$ per person 16,680 constant 2015 US$ per person Norway

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
